    Yeah the part list should suffice for the games that you outlined. RAM prices are MAD low right now so the 16GB of RAM is recommended. If you do have the extra money I would suggest purchasing an SSD as a boot drive and for your main games. This would allow significantly faster boost speeds of Windows and the games on the SSD. 

     


  3. Building a PC yourself is typically much more economical than buying a prebuilt PC from reputable businesses. A "cheap" PC would probably be around $550 to get solid performance but costs could be cut in certain places if truly needed. Below is my recommendation on what you should buy in terms of parts.
